One of the crucial aspects of maintaining a clean and healthy swimming pool is to keep the pH levels in check. pH refers to the acidic or alkaline nature of water, and it plays a vital role in water chemistry. If the pH levels are not properly balanced, it can result in various issues such as skin irritation, corrosion of pool equipment, and reduced effectiveness of chlorine. Why is pH balance crucial for a swimming pool?
Understanding why pH balance is crucial for a swimming pool is essential. Ideally, the pH levels of a swimming pool should be between 7.2 and 7.8, which is slightly alkaline. When the pH levels deviate from this range:
- Low pH (acidic): Water becomes corrosive, causing damage to pool equipment, the pool surface, and even swimmers’ skin and eyes.
- High pH (alkaline): The effectiveness of chlorine is reduced, potentially leading to cloudy water, algae growth, and an increased risk of infections.
How to lower the pool pH?
Lowering pool pH involves a step-by-step process. Follow these guidelines to achieve the desired pH levels:
- Test the water: Use a reliable pH testing kit to determine the current pH levels of your pool water. This will help you measure the effectiveness of your adjustments.
- Add pH Decreaser: Based on the test results, determine the amount of pH decreaser (usually muriatic acid or sodium bisulfate) needed to lower the pH levels. Carefully follow the manufacturer’s instructions to avoid any accidents or chemical imbalances.
- Pre-dilute the pH Decreaser: To prevent any potential chemical reactions, pre-dilute the pH decreaser in a bucket of water before adding it to the pool. This will ensure a safe and controlled application.
- Distribute evenly: Pour the pre-diluted pH decreaser solution around the perimeter of the pool while the filter system is running. This will help distribute the pH decreaser evenly throughout the water.
- Re-test the water: Wait for about 6-8 hours and re-test the pH levels of your pool water. If necessary, repeat the process until the desired pH range is achieved.
Additional tips for maintaining pH balance:
While the process mentioned above will help you lower the pool pH effectively, here are some additional tips to maintain pH balance:
- Regular testing: It is important to regularly test the pH levels of your swimming pool using a reliable testing kit. This will allow you to catch any imbalances early and make necessary adjustments.
- Keep other chemical levels in check: Ensure your pool’s alkalinity and calcium hardness levels are within the recommended ranges. Imbalances in these factors can affect pH stability.
- Monitor chlorine levels: Chlorine acts as a disinfectant and helps maintain water clarity. Properly balanced chlorine levels will enhance pH stability.
- Seek professional help: If you are unsure about adjusting the pH levels yourself or are facing persistent issues, it is advisable to seek assistance from a professional pool service provider.
